mayblossom Posted May 18, 2017 Author Share Posted May 18, 2017 Don't some folding campers have a toilet compartment with a cassette toilet and washbasin?We always have a look at the shows,but they seem to cost almost as much as caravans and take up almost as much space. Some do have a toilet and washbasin but ours didn't as they take up a fair bit of room and are not exactly private the larger ones are ok but we went for the Conway Countryman as it fitted easily into the garage, the Fiesta, which has the loo, was very tiny and the side wall was a bit wobbly. ..also had a plastic see through window on one side! Apart from that they are lovely and is luxury camping but basically still a tent. .....and a cold one at that.
